How to fill out heat transfer study of

01
Start by gathering all the necessary information related to the heat transfer study, such as the system or equipment being analyzed, the materials involved, and the operating conditions.
02
Identify the specific heat transfer mechanisms that are relevant to the study, such as conduction, convection, and radiation.
03
Begin by analyzing the conduction heat transfer, which involves the transfer of heat through solids.
04
Calculate the thermal conductivity of the materials involved and determine the temperature gradient across the solids.
05
Next, analyze the convective heat transfer, which involves the transfer of heat through fluids or gases.
06
Determine the convective heat transfer coefficient and the temperature difference between the fluid and the solid surface.
07
Lastly, analyze the radiative heat transfer, which involves the transfer of heat through electromagnetic waves.
08
Consider factors such as the emissivity and surface area of the solid objects involved.
09
Combine the results of the conduction, convection, and radiation analysis to determine the overall heat transfer rate.
10
Present your findings in a clear and organized manner, including any assumptions or limitations made during the study.
